Alison Gray Recruitment are delighted to be recruiting for Class 2 Drivers for our client in Ballyclare.
Hourly Rate: £14.50
Location: Ballyclare
Hours: Monday - Friday 8am - 5pm (flexibility required)
Responsibilities:
- Tail lift on lorries
- Manual handling
- Curtainside
- Load and unload with forklift
What You Can Bring:
- 1+ years Class 2 experience
- Valid CPC and Tacho card
- Good geographical knowledge

How to prepare for a job interview at Alison Gray Recruitment
✨Know Your Routes
Brush up on your geographical knowledge of the area around Ballyclare. Being able to discuss local routes and traffic patterns can show your potential employer that you're not just a driver, but someone who understands the importance of efficient navigation.
✨Showcase Your Experience
With over a year of Class 2 driving experience, make sure to highlight specific examples from your past roles. Talk about your familiarity with tail lifts, manual handling, and using forklifts. This will demonstrate your hands-on skills and readiness for the job.
✨CPC and Tacho Card Ready
Ensure you have your valid CPC and Tacho card at hand during the interview. Being prepared with these documents not only shows your professionalism but also reassures the employer that you meet the legal requirements for the role.
✨Flexibility is Key
Since the job requires flexibility in hours, be ready to discuss your availability. Highlight any previous experiences where you adapted to changing schedules or demands, showing that you’re a reliable team player who can handle the unexpected.
